Seashore Plants of South Florida and the Caribbean is a complete source for information about which plants grow best in nearshore environments. It includes extensive characteristics of each plant, including:
- Form, flower and fruit date
- Geographic distribution and habitat
- Reproduction and propagation
- Ornamental uses
- Medicinal and toxic properties, including modern and folkloric beliefs and uses
- Ecological aspects
